I was recently sent a sample of Food Should Taste Good’s newest flavored chips. I was able to try the White Cheddar and the Toasted Sesame. I have to say, the name of the company says it all. Food SHOULD taste good, and this company makes sure that it does. Their products are made with high quality natural ingredients. There are so many perks to these chips (some might call them crackers). This is a partial description from the Food Should Taste Good website:
All chip varieties are gluten free, cholesterol free, have no trans fats and do not use genetically modified ingredients (GMOs). They are also certified Kosher, low in sodium and are a good source of dietary fiber. The chips combine the crunchiness of a chip, the crispiness of a cracker, and the dippability of a tortilla chip.
My truly unbiased opinion is that this product holds true to all of its claims. These are not going to be like your “normal” potato chip. They are not thin or greasy. In fact, the Food Should Taste Good chips are very hearty. They have a deep grain flavor and texture. The cheese on the White Cheddar variety is delicious, just like REAL cheese. The Toasted Sesame variety is definitely best with some type of dip (try hummus or salsa….YUM!). These are definitely a snack worthy of a curled up on the couch TV session.
